- The distance between Porto , Portugal and Mackar Inlet, Nt, Canada is approximately 5,300 km or 3,293 mi.
- To reach Porto in this distance one would set out from Mackar Inlet, Nt bearing 83.3°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Porto bearing 150.8° or SSE .
- Porto has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b) whereas Mackar Inlet, Nt has a tundra climate (ET).
- Porto is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Mackar Inlet, Nt is in or near the polar desert biome.
- The annual average temperature is 29.2 °C (52.6°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 27 °C (48.6°F) less in Porto . The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1078 mm (42.4 in) more which is equivalent to 1078 l/m² (26.46 US gal/ft²) or 10,780,000 l/ha (1,152,454 US gal/ac) more. About 6 5/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 27.1° higher in Porto than in Mackar Inlet, Nt.
